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3447 5910282786 7071561775
2069322 0407 22
2069322 0407 22
8604998 951 591605
All about undefined
Interested in learning more?
2069322 0407 22
8604998 951 591605
See more
1252473 9656
506 9855084839 95733415147 366
See more
0227 1509913 736528
74 68860877 74855527281 4676 0643
See more